Output 126e5c60c2bf3185acaf450bdbb2e2da1b956a6ac8b9fa6cb4e91fddd1e8f069:1

value
19976
script pubkey
OP_0 OP_PUSHBYTES_20 509410f41ec888b66d97b4eb3a65be06dae26e23
address
bc1q2z2ppaq7ezytvmvhkn4n5ed7qmdwym3ryr7wwc
transaction
126e5c60c2bf3185acaf450bdbb2e2da1b956a6ac8b9fa6cb4e91fddd1e8f069
confirmations
63616
spent
true